What It Is

Based on the captured page content, thesolutionfirm.com appears to be a website focused on cybersecurity services and training. Its navigation repeatedly includes sections such as Company, Training, Services, Resources, News, and Contact Us. Clearly identifiable cybersecurity-related offerings include Cyber Security Certification Training, Certification and Skills Training, Training Material, Security Assessment, Breach and Incident Response, and Expert Witness. Overall, it looks more like a security consulting and training provider than a product vendor for firewalls, EDR, WAF, or SIEM solutions.

Pricing and Commercial Transparency

The page content does not list prices, packages, subscription models, project-based quotes, or free consultation options, nor does it disclose payment methods. As a result, value for money can only be assessed conservatively. For enterprise procurement, follow-up due diligence should clarify key terms such as pricing basis, service boundaries, deliverables, response times, consultant qualifications, and confidentiality agreements.
